Job Description:
- Reviews and interprets IRS guidelines on ERC credits related to client’s specific situation.
- Analyzes client’s payroll, including all employer related costs and quarterly tax returns.
- Determines eligible amounts of payroll and enters required data into proprietary software to calculate ERC credits.
- Submits completed calculations to assigned Financial Analyst for further processing.
- Maintains records of all submissions.
- Protects confidentiality of client data.
